What is TTU Blackboard?
TTU Blackboard is the customized version of the Blackboard Learn LMS tailored for Texas Tech University students, faculty, and staff. It provides an integrated environment where instructors can upload course materials, assignments, and tests while students can access these resources, submit assignments, and interact with their peers and instructors.
Key Features of TTU Blackboard:
a. Course Content: Instructors can upload lectures, readings, videos, and other course materials. This ensures that students have a centralized hub for all their academic needs.
b. Assignments and Assessments: Instructors can create and grade assignments and quizzes beyond sharing content. Students can submit their work directly through the platform.
c. Discussion Boards: Students can discuss topics, ask questions, and collaborate on projects. It fosters a sense of community and active learning.
d. Grade Center: Both instructors and students can track academic progress. Students can see their grades, and instructors can manage and post grades for assignments, tests, and participation.
e. Collaboration Tools: Integrates tools like Blackboard Collaborate, a real-time video conferencing tool that allows virtual classrooms, office hours, and guest lectures.

A Step-by-step Guide to Using TTU Blackboard:
a. Logging In. To access TTU Blackboard, navigate to the official TTU Blackboard portal. Use your eRaider credentials (username and password) to log in.
b. Dashboard Overview: Once logged in, you’ll find a dashboard displaying your enrolled courses, announcements, and a calendar with important dates.
c. Accessing Courses: Click on a course title to enter the course shell. You’ll find various sections like content, discussions, and grades inside.
d. Submitting Assignments: Navigate to your course’s ‘Assignments’ tab. Click on the assignment title, attach your work, and hit ‘Submit.’
e. Participating in Discussions: Under the ‘Discussions’ tab, you can start a new thread or reply to existing ones.
f. Checking Grades: The ‘Grades’ tab provides an overview of your scores and feedback.
g. Communicating: Use the email or messaging function to communicate with peers or instructors.

How do I access TTU Blackboard?
Navigate to the official TTU Blackboard portal and log in using your eRaider credentials (username and password). If you’re a first-time user, ensure you’ve activated your retailer account.
Can I access TTU Blackboard on mobile devices?
 Yes, Blackboard offers a mobile app for Android and iOS. Once downloaded, select Texas Tech University as your institution and log in using your eRaider credentials.
